
5 x BXL
onstage creation by Pierre Larauza and Emmanuelle Vincent / t.r.a.n.s.i.t.s.c.a.p.e
On stage, five bodies personify remarkable choreographic stories. Marianne, Robert, Nil, Lucie and Ibrahima share their personal approaches to movement linked to their own personal journeys.
Spurred by a desire to document choreographic plurality, Pierre Larauza and Emmanuelle Vincent highlight these multiple portraits of the moving body that reveal people invested in dance, sport or even a different kind of physical practice.
“ Sufi dance, aerial silk, contortion, crossfit, i-dop- ! ball... a show which honours the diversity of movement in Brussels ! ”
